First things first-licences and where you can play. I'll keep it tight here and expand below if you need the fine print.

  • Ontario play is regulated by AGCO/iGO (verify in the AGCO public registry). Outside Ontario, check the operator's footer for current authorization before you sign up. Licensing status can shift-double‑check the footer links and the regulator's public page on the day you join.

  • Travelling from Ottawa to Gatineau? Here's what happened to my login: I crossed the bridge to grab poutine, fired up the app, and got blocked until I switched to the site that matched my new location. GeoComply is strict-and it should be.

    • In Ontario: use the Ontario site; location checks run at login and during play.
    • Elsewhere in Canada: use the rest‑of‑Canada site in the province/territory you're physically in.

    You can't use the Ontario instance outside Ontario (and vice‑versa). If you move provinces, switch sites. VPNs won't help-GeoComply will flag it.

Accounts and verification essentials

Sign‑up, age rules, KYC, and 2FA-two minutes, then you're good.

  • Pick the site that matches where you are physically. Inside Ontario, use the Ontario site; elsewhere in Canada, use the rest‑of‑Canada site. Click Join, enter your details, and accept the terms. You must be 19+ to play. GeoComply confirms your location at login. One account per person. Be accurate-mismatches slow verification and payouts. Travelling? Log in on the site instance that matches your current province/territory.

  • You'll need a government‑issued photo ID (driver's licence or passport) and recent proof of address. A recent hydro bill or bank statement works-make sure your name and postal code are clearly visible. The team may also verify your payment method. Upload right after registration so withdrawals aren't delayed. Send clear, uncropped images showing all corners; watch for follow‑ups if anything is blurry or cut off.

  • Use Forgot Password to reset by email. No access to that inbox? Contact support and be ready with ID and answers to security questions. Don't create a second account-that breaks the rules. Keep your email current in your profile so reset links arrive, and enable 2FA as a safety net on trusted devices. It's quick and saves headaches later.

  • Edit address, phone, and preferences in your profile. If you've moved, upload fresh proof of address (hydro or internet bill with your current postal code). Add/remove payment methods in the cashier; new cards or bank details may need verification. Name changes require official documents. If a field is locked, ping support-compliance has to approve certain edits.

  • Yes. Head to Security settings, turn on 2FA, and pair an authenticator app. Keep your backup codes somewhere safe. Don't share codes. I'm not a security engineer, but this took me about a minute-and it's worth it for faster verification on sensitive requests.

Bonuses and promotions explained

Short answers first; I'll flag any gotchas where they pop up.

  • Expect a first‑wager or first‑deposit match and a set of bonus spins. Example: 100% up to $250 plus 100 spins on selected Playtech slots (e.g., Shark Blitz or Sahara Riches). Minimum $10 deposit is common. Offers can differ between Ontario and the rest of Canada-check the live details on the bonuses & promotions page before you opt in.

  • I used to think 30x meant thirty spins-wrong. It's thirty times the bonus (or spins winnings) before you can cash out. First reaction: 30x sounds rough; on second thought, it's standard here-just mind the max‑bet rule.

    Typical figures: 30x on spins winnings or bonus credits; some second/third deposits climb to 40x. Slots usually contribute 100%; many table games contribute less. Track progress in your account to avoid accidental breaches while wagering.

  • Seven days is common for bonus/spins expiry, but it varies. Promotions rarely stack unless the terms say so. If you've got active wagering, new bonus acceptance may be blocked. Sportsbook promos run separately-confirm if you can hold casino and sportsbook offers at the same time, then check expiry dates in your bonus wallet before you bet.

  • Refresh the lobby and check your Bonuses section. Make sure you met the qualifying rules (e.g., minimum deposit or odds). Still missing? Grab screenshots, note your deposit reference, and ask live chat for a manual credit review. Get a ticket number and an ETA if it needs escalation. Avoid wagering on the affected games until it's sorted to protect eligibility.

  • Yes-NorthStar ELITE is by invitation based on gameplay patterns, responsible‑gaming standing, and account tenure. Perks can include tailored offers, event invites, and priority support. Thresholds aren't public and can change. If invited, read the VIP terms closely-especially any bespoke wagering rules. Responsible play first; you can opt out anytime.

Payments, limits, and payout timelines

Cashier basics in plain terms-then a quick rule of thumb for speed.

  • Minimum deposit: typically $10 CAD, processed instantly for supported methods.
  • Minimum withdrawal: typically $10 CAD, subject to verification checks.
  • Typical withdrawal ceilings appear around $50k/30 days, but your limit shows in the cashier.
  • Visa, Mastercard, Interac, and iDebit are supported. Deposits are instant for most options. Withdrawals try to use the same rails. Interac e‑Transfer lands as "AutoDeposit" at most banks (RBC/TD/BMO)-you'll get an app ping or email/text. Approve the first one and future cashouts usually auto‑deposit. No crypto. Availability can differ by Ontario vs rest‑of‑Canada. Your name must match across account, ID, and payment method. For the breakdown, see payment methods.

  • Withdrawals? A day to review-usually. Then the bank dance. Interac tends to be fastest once approved.

    Rough guide: internal review ~24 hours (up to 72 if extra checks). After approval, Interac often hits in 1-3 business days; cards and iDebit are closer to 3-5 business days. Finish KYC early to avoid slowdowns, especially on bigger wins or when you change payment details.

  • No house fees for deposits or withdrawals. Accounts run in CAD. Your bank/card might add exchange or cash‑advance fees if your funding source isn't CAD. Using Interac helps avoid FX surprises-keep an eye on your statement just in case.

  • You can usually cancel while it's pending review. Find the request in your cashier and hit cancel if the option shows. Once approved, cancellation is unlikely. If you can't cancel in the cashier, ask chat to check status. For safer bankroll management, skip cancelling approved withdrawals to keep yourself from chasing losses.

Interac cleared for me in under two days-requested Thursday afternoon, landed Monday morning. Rule of thumb: Interac first (fast), cards if you must (slower).

Responsible gaming tools and help

Play for fun, not for a payday-set a budget and stick to it.

  • Warning signs: chasing losses, hiding spend, borrowing, mood swings, skipping work or plans. Gambling is entertainment-if it stops feeling that way, take a break. Start with limits or a short time‑out. If you need longer, self‑exclude. Talking to a counsellor early helps even if you feel "fine" today. Step‑by‑step setup lives in the responsible gaming tools guide.

  • Set deposit limits daily, weekly, or monthly. Loss caps and session timers help too. Use a time‑out for a short reset; choose self‑exclusion for six months, a year, or five years if you need a longer break. During self‑exclusion, you can't log in or open new accounts. Full how‑to lives in responsible gaming tools.

  • Ontario: ConnexOntario 1‑866‑531‑2600 (free, confidential). Elsewhere: GamCare (UK), BeGambleAware, Gamblers Anonymous, and Gambling Therapy for 24/7 online chat. US: NCPG 1‑800‑522‑4700. Save the number you'll actually call-future you will thank you.

Troubleshooting and technical help

Quick fixes first; then what to tell support so they can actually solve it.

  • Check your internet and try a fresh tab. Update your browser. Disable aggressive ad‑blockers and allow pop‑ups for the cashier. Clear cache/cookies and restart. Still stuck? Try another browser or device. When you contact support, include browser version, device model, timestamp, and any error codes-those details matter for tech teams.

Don't spam refresh-tempting, I know. Close and reopen the game; it should restore to the correct state.

If it doesn't, take a timestamped screenshot and contact chat with the game name and round ID. Live‑table outcomes are server‑logged and settled by the rules. A steady Wi‑Fi or data connection reduces the chance of mid‑round drops.

  • Use the latest Chrome, Firefox, Safari, or Edge. Enable cookies/JavaScript and allow location permissions. On desktop, keep GPU drivers current for smoother live video. On mobile, close bandwidth‑hungry background apps. Avoid VPNs/proxies-they break GeoComply and access. Clear cache if pages look out of date after an update push.

  • Enable location services for your browser/app. On desktop, allow the prompt and keep Wi‑Fi on (even with Ethernet). Disable VPNs, proxies, and remote‑desktop tools. On mobile, toggle Airplane mode off/on to refresh. Near a border, move further inside the province/territory. If it persists, send device details and a short error description to support.
